The Best Materials for Creating an Exotic Sex Doll: Silicone vs. TPE

When it comes to exotic sex dolls, the materials used in their construction play a crucial role in determining the doll’s feel, appearance, and durability. The two most common materials used are silicone and thermoplastic elastomer (TPE), each offering distinct advantages and disadvantages.

Silicone is known for its superior durability and lifelike texture. It has a firm yet soft feel that closely mimics human skin. Silicone dolls tend to have a more realistic appearance, with smoother and more detailed features. They are also resistant to bacteria, making them easier to clean and maintain. However, silicone dolls tend to be heavier and more expensive compared to TPE options, which can be a consideration for buyers on a budget.

TPE, on the other hand, is more flexible and softer than silicone, which some users prefer for a more lifelike, pliable experience. TPE dolls are generally more affordable, making them a popular choice for those who want a high-quality doll without the higher price tag. However, TPE is more porous than silicone, which means it requires more maintenance to ensure cleanliness and longevity.

Ultimately, the choice between silicone and TPE depends on the user’s preferences regarding feel, maintenance, and budget. Both materials have their benefits, and selecting the right one will depend on what you value most in a sex doll.
